The purpose of this project was to find the volume of an object, similar to the the shape of a coke

bottle, using only calculus. We did this by measuring the width and height of the bottle, and

creating lines to fit the curves of the bottle. Then, we used desmos.com (a virtual graphing

calculator) to graph the bottle and make sure it has the correct shape. Then, using calculus, we

split the bottle into sections and found the volume of each sections. Adding the sections together,

we found the volume of the bottle. We then compared it to the actual volume, to see how

accurate our calculations were.

I used a Dr. Pepper bottle for my experiment, and followed the above outline to measure. As you

can see below, my graph looked very accurate and fit the shape of the bottle. When I had

finished, my calculations were only a few 100 mL off. While it was slightly off, it was still very

accurate for the work we did.
